Sandbach & District Talking Newspaper is a Registered Charity, set up in 1986 with the objective of assisting those in our local community who are visually impaired, or those suffering some temporary or permanent incapacity or disability which makes reading a strain, by the provision of recorded or tactile reading matter.

Each fortnight we produce “NEWSWEEK”, our local Talking Newspaper, in which we record items of local news with views, information and readers’ letters from the local newspapers onto digital memory sticks for our listeners.

The stories are read from the local newspapers covering the areas:

  • Sandbach
  • Middlewich
  • Alsager
  • Holmes Chapel
  • Goostrey

In addition we produce special recordings. These include monthly extracts from the prestigious Cheshire Life magazine and extracts from the quarterly This England and Evergreen magazines as well.

To meet this task, our volunteers include:

  • Editors
  • Readers & Relief Readers
  • Recording Technicians & Relief Technicians
  • Copiers
  • Administrators
  • Trustees & Committee members
